My younger days were before
the popularity of Young Adult novels (and well before eBooks), so when I
outgrew children’s “Chapter Books” I started reading more adult books – Stephen
King and Michael Crichton in particular. These brought me into a world of
sci-fi, and I was solidified as a sci-fi fan when I picked up Carl Sagan’s
“Contact”. This book is a “it could happen” type sci-fi adventure. It is based
on Earth (although, at this point, it’s pre-cell phones, internet, and social
media, so it’s not a very realistic Earth now) with a bunch of individuals that
are able to make contact with life outside of Earth. Will they be able to leave
the planet to make face-to-face Contact? The story deals with life outside of
Earth, but also humanity itself and what it means to believe.
